gwlanek

Cornish

Etymology

From gwlan (wool) + -ek.

Pronunciation

  • (Revived Middle Cornish) IPA(key): [ˈɡwlanɛk]
  • (Revived Middle Cornish) IPA(key): [ˈɡwlɒnɐk]

Adjective

gwlanek

  1. woollen, woolly
